Comment(by elvix):
Replying to [comment:23 erikrose]:
> * How much do products currently depend on Collections API that would
change? How popular are custom criteria in the wild? These could hurt
hands-free migration, so I like Calvin's idea of a manual, optional
migration.
I don't know about others but : We (Jarn) commonly add criteria
registrations for new indexes. We almost never write custom criteria
types. I think the latter is very uncommon.
> * I'd encourage the implementors to work closely with Hanno on this to
make sure any API changes change once: not now and then again in 5. It
sounds like they already have this in mind.
We share offices with Hanno, and would never do this without consulting
him.
> * Can we get a UI (''any'' UI) for reordering Subfolders along with
this? I've had that request and personally done the crazy ZMI manual-
bubble-sort workarounds for it.
What is reordering subfolders and how does this relate to collections?
Subfolders in collections? Shouldn't they use the same ui as other
subfolders do? I don't think this PLIP will supply any such UI.
